Overview


Name   covR   Type   Regulator
Locus tag   SMUNN2025_RS01245 Genome accession   NC_013928
Coordinates   255721..256413 (+) Length   230 a.a.
NCBI ID   WP_002262121.1    Uniprot ID   -
Organism   Streptococcus mutans NN2025     
Function   repress comR expression (predicted from homology)   
Competence regulation
